                                                   Our Forever Friend

               KEY VERSE - John 15:14 – "You are my friends if you do what I command."

We often hear terms like BFF, Bestie, Sister (or brother), Homie used to describe friendships.

Throughout the Bible we see many different types of friendships. We also can receive the wisdom on how to be a good friend. 

 

The dictionary says this about the word friendship: a relationship between friends - a state of mutual trust and support. Similar words include: association, bond, companionship, fellowship, closeness, unity, harmony 

 

We all desire companionship and closeness, someone we can share our joys and our struggles with. But, what if I told you that your greatest friendship could be with God Himself? Because of Jesus, and through Him, we are invited into an eternal covenant and friendship with our Heavenly Father. This relationship with God will never disappoint and will never fade away.

 

The Bible talks about either being a friend of God or being an enemy of God. 

James 4:4 “You adulterous people! Don’t you realize that friendship with the world makes you an enemy of God? So whoever wants to be a friend of the world becomes an enemy of God.” This verse uses the imagery of adultery to illustrate the unfaithfulness of being a friend of the world, which is a betrayal of God. It emphasizes that choosing the world’s ways is a direct opposition to God’s ways, making one an enemy.

We can continue to love and appreciate our earthly friendships, but it is our relationship with God that should make us full of joy and gratitude!

 

 

   What the Word Says about Friendships/Relationships:

 

God designed us for relationships. Genesis 2:18

“It is not good that the man should be alone; I will make him a helper fit for him.”

             God knew from the beginning that it was not good for Adam to be alone. It highlights the

             Importance of companionship and the basic human need for relationships.

Faith makes us friends with God. James 2:2

          “Abraham believed God, and it was credited to him as righteousness, and he was 

             called God’s friend.”

            Our friendship with God is not based on our performance, but in our faith and trust in the

            The One who created us. When we place our faith in Jesus, we too become friends with 

            God. Trust is always a key component for relationships to flourish. Knowing God 

            Intimately helps us to trust Him more, and as we know Him more, we come to know His 

           Faithfulness and love towards us.  

 

The Problem - Sin Separated us from God. Romans 6:23

“For the wages of sin is death, but the gift of God is eternal life in Christ Jesus

Our LORD.”

            Sin has a cost. It is eternal separation from God, and Heaven. However, God does  

            offer us an incredible gift - eternal life through Jesus Christ. We can not earn this gift. 

            We receive it through our faith. Sometimes our sinful nature and behavior can ruin our 

            earthly relationships. It is only through God’s love that we are truly able to maintain and

            thrive in our relationships here on earth, and in our personal relationship with Jesus.  

 

The Solution - Jesus’ Love and Sacrifice John 3:16

            “For God so loved the world, that he gave his one and only Son, so that everyone

            Who believes in him shall not perish but have eternal life.”

            God’s love for us is so great that He sent Jesus, as a sacrifice for our sins. That sacrifice 

            bridges the gap that sin created between us and God, offering us the chance to be

            restored to a right relationship with Him. God will always make a way for us to be 

            restored back to Him.

       

Forgiveness and New Life 1 John 1:9 and 1 Peter 1:3-4

            “If we confess our sins to him, he is faithful and just to forgive us our sins and to 

             Cleanse us from all wickedness.”

             “All praise to God, the Father of our LORD Jesus Christ. It is by his great mercy     

             that we have been born again, because God raised Jesus Christ from the dead.

             Now we live with great expectation, and we have a priceless inheritance –

             an inheritance that is kept in Heaven for you, pure and undefiled, beyond the 

             reach of change and decay.”

             Through Jesus’ resurrection, we receive new life, a living hope, and a future that is 

             secure with Him for eternity.

 

Our Response - Following Jesus John 15:14

            “You are my Friends if you do as I command.”

             When we follow in Jesus’ footsteps and do as the Bible instructs us, we become friends

             with God. We show our love and commitment to Jesus by living according to His Word,

             trusting Him in all things, and sharing His love with others.

                   

Are you a friend of God? Are you deepening your friendship with Him through prayer and reading the Word? How can you share this incredible friendship with others?

Let us embrace this eternal friendship with gratitude and commitment, knowing that God is always with us.
